Spa and Wellness: The Other Key Criterion by the Lake
By Lake Geneva, the spa is not merely an addition. It often carries as much weight as the room, terrace, or view. Guests come here to unwind, recharge, and maintain a true rhythm of stay. This is particularly true for a long weekend, but also for four or five nights. In our view, a great spa is not just about a treatment menu. We consider the space, the flow of movement, the quality of the pools, the presence of wet areas, and the ability to make guests forget the outside world upon arrival. It is also important to note the coherence between the hotel and its wellness universe. A historic palace does not express care in the same way as a contemporary resort. Yet, the best establishments achieve this balance. They create a lasting sense of recovery without turning the stay into a medical programme.

For a Romantic Getaway: Which Addresses to Choose
For couples, a good hotel is not just about a beautiful room. It also requires the right atmosphere. By Lake Geneva, we first look for genuine intimacy. The size of the terraces matters. The orientation towards the lake is also significant. Late room service, the discretion of the staff, and the evening ambiance often make a difference. For an anniversary, we prefer places where dining can be enjoyed without leaving the hotel. For a long weekend, we favour those that allow for a mix of walks, spa time, and leisurely mornings by the water. For a honeymoon, we seek a sense of seclusion. This can come from a park, a balcony, a high floor, or a well-designed spa.
Among the most reliable options, the Beau-Rivage Palace in Lausanne remains a reference for couples seeking a grand hotel without rigidity. Its lakeside location, set within a vast park, creates a rare sense of space. The rooms and suites facing Lake Geneva are best suited for two. This address is well-suited for significant anniversaries. It also works well for a long weekend, thanks to its spa and on-site dining. In Geneva, the Hôtel d’Angleterre appeals more to couples who prefer a more intimate setting. Its smaller size fosters a very attentive service relationship. Rooms with views of the Jet d’Eau and the lake provide an immediately appealing backdrop. This is a relevant option for a short escape, with dining, room service, and a straightforward return to the room.
For a more residential atmosphere, La Réserve Genève Hotel, Spa and Villa offers a different experience. Its location, away from the city centre, encourages disconnection. This is often what couples seek for three nights or more. The hotel combines a green environment, a substantial spa, and several dining spaces. This trio works well when each partner wants their own pace. One can linger at the spa while the other enjoys the terrace or lakeside. In the same spirit of a complete stay, the Royal Plaza Montreux deserves attention from travellers who wish to stay close to the Vaud Riviera. The lakeside promenade begins almost at the doorstep. Rooms with balconies overlooking Lake Geneva should be prioritised. For couples, this continuity between room, view, and easy access is a real advantage.
If your idea of romance involves hotel history, Fairmont Le Montreux Palace holds a particular allure. The Belle Époque building, its lakeside position, and the immediate proximity to the quay create a compelling setting. We readily recommend it for a celebration for two. The service is well-versed in accommodating memorable stays. In Vevey, the Grand Hotel du Lac offers a more tranquil experience. Its more measured scale and direct relationship with the lake appeal to couples wishing to avoid large crowds. It is a good choice for a two-night retreat. The pace feels more relaxed in the evenings. Also noteworthy is the Four Seasons Hotel des Bergues Geneva. For an urban honeymoon, it combines an international signature, a spa, and a central location. The city-lake duo works well here, especially for travellers wanting to alternate shopping, dining, and a quick return to the hotel.
Finally, our advice is to choose the hotel based on the type of memory you wish to create. To mark a special date, Beau-Rivage Palace and Fairmont Le Montreux Palace offer the most theatrical settings. For an elegant and easily organised weekend, Hôtel d’Angleterre and Grand Hotel du Lac are very convincing. For a longer stay, La Réserve Genève and Royal Plaza Montreux provide greater ease. And for a honeymoon with well-structured service, Four Seasons Hotel des Bergues Geneva remains a solid option. What our advisors often observe is simple. By Lake Geneva, romance arises less from the decor alone than from the fluidity of the stay. A beautiful view matters. But true success lies in the sequence: arriving swiftly, dining well, sleeping peacefully, and waking up to the lake.
